TITLE: GCN CIRCULAR NUMBER: 36640 SUBJECT: GRB 240606B: Fermi GBM Observation DATE: 24/06/07 20:17:18 GMT FROM: sumanbala2210@gmail.com S. Bala (USRA) and C. Meegan (UAH) report on behalf of the Fermi Gamma-ray Burst Monitor Team: "At 13:33:06.09 UT on 06 June 2024, the Fermi Gamma-ray Burst Monitor (GBM) triggered and located GRB 240606B (trigger 739373591/240606565). which was also detected by Swift/BAT-GUANO (DeLaunay et al. 2024, GCN 36628). The Fermi GBM on-ground location is consistent with the Swift-BAT/GUANO position. The angle from the Fermi LAT boresight is 141 degrees. The GBM light curve consists of a single emission episode with a duration (T90) of about 11 s (50-300 keV). The time-averaged spectrum from T0-6.9 to T0+8.4 s is best fit by a power law function with an exponential high-energy cutoff. The power law index is -1.2 +/- 0.1 and the cutoff energy, parameterized as Epeak, is 310 +/- 60 keV. A Band function fits the spectrum equally well with Epeak= 238 +/- 75 keV, alpha = -1.11 +/- 0.16 and beta = -2.28 +/- 0.41. The event fluence (10-1000 keV) in this time interval is (6.4 +/- 0.5)E-06 erg/cm^2. The 1-sec peak photon flux measured starting from T0+0.51 s in the 10-1000 keV band is 7.9 +/- 0.7 ph/s/cm^2.
